Buyers of the all-electric Mercedes-Benz EQS will be able to choose a grille like the Mercedes-Benz S-Class.

Mercedes-Benz plans to start selling the restyled Mercedes EQS in June this year. The updated electric car will be available with both the existing "sleek" front fascia and a more familiar "radiator grille" like the one fitted to the Mercedes-Benz S-Class.

This was announced by Mercedes-Benz CEO Ola Kallenius during the recent presentation of the company's report for the past year.

During the event, the company also showed an image of the new design element of the Mercedes EQS front end, emphasising its similarity to the one used in the flagship model with an internal combustion engine. In this image, the EQS is positioned on the left and the S-Class is on the right.

According to Kallenius, the EQS will also feature an upgraded battery with a new battery chemistry that will increase range .

The upgraded EQS will be available from June, although cars with the new battery are likely to go into production earlier, he said.

The battery is likely to be the same as on the updated EQS SUV, where the capacity was increased from 108 kWh to 118 kWh. This boost has provided an additional 50 kilometres of range. so with comparable changes, the sedan will be able to travel almost 800 kilometres on a single charge.
